Painting Description
Louis Masreliez, a prominent Swedish artist and designer, is renowned for his contributions to the neoclassical style in Sweden. One of his notable works is the "Vaggdekoration for Sofia Magdalenas vaning pa Stockholms slott," which translates to "Wall Decoration for Sofia Magdalena's Apartment at Stockholm Palace." This piece was created during the late 18th century, a period when Masreliez was actively involved in the artistic transformation of Stockholm Palace.
The decoration was part of a larger project to refurbish the royal apartments, reflecting the neoclassical aesthetic that was gaining popularity in Europe at the time. Masreliez, who had studied in Paris and Rome, brought a sophisticated understanding of classical art and architecture to his work. His designs often incorporated elements such as symmetry, classical motifs, and a restrained color palette, all of which are evident in the wall decoration for Sofia Magdalena's apartment.
Sofia Magdalena, the Queen of Sweden, was married to King Gustav III. Her apartment in Stockholm Palace was intended to reflect her status and the cultural aspirations of the Swedish court. Masreliez's work contributed to creating an environment that was both elegant and modern, aligning with the Enlightenment ideals that Gustav III championed.
The wall decoration is characterized by intricate patterns and motifs inspired by ancient Greek and Roman art. Masreliez's use of ornamental details, such as garlands, medallions, and mythological figures, showcases his skill in blending artistic influences to create a harmonious and sophisticated interior space. The work not only served a decorative purpose but also symbolized the cultural and intellectual ambitions of the Swedish monarchy during this period.
Today, Masreliez's contributions to Stockholm Palace are recognized as significant examples of neoclassical art in Sweden. His work in Sofia Magdalena's apartment remains a testament to his artistic vision and the broader cultural movements of the 18th century.
